Preventing Wear and Tear
Delicate fibers in oriental rugs are prone to wear and tear, which can lessen their beauty and structural integrity over time. To preserve these intricate textiles, it is vital to implement preventative measures. Regular vacuuming helps eliminate dust and dirt that can cause abrasions. Furthermore, placing rugs in low-traffic areas or using rug pads can minimize friction and guard against heavy footfall. Direct sunlight exposure should be limited, as UV rays can weaken fibers and fade colors. Moreover, rotating rugs periodically guarantees even wear across all areas. By adopting these practices, rug owners can significantly extend the lifespan of their prized possessions, maintaining their aesthetic appeal and structural strength for generations to come.
Expert Cleaning Solutions
Specialized cleaning methods play an essential role in preserving the integrity of delicate fibers in oriental rugs. These methods are designed to address the specific characteristics of diverse materials, including silk and fine wool, which can be particularly prone to damage. Professional cleaners utilize gentle cleaning solutions and low-pressure rinsing to avoid fiber distortion and color bleeding. Additionally, approaches such as dry cleaning or solvent-based cleaning are employed for delicate fabrics that cannot withstand water exposure. Moreover, experts assess each rug's specific needs, ensuring that stains and dirt are removed without compromising the fibers. By using customized approaches, professionals maintain the aesthetic appeal and structural integrity of these valuable textiles, ultimately extending their lifespan and improving their beauty.
Eliminating Deep-Set Dirt and Allergens
Ingrained dirt and allergens commonly gather in the fibers of oriental rugs, making proper cleaning vital for both aesthetics and health. Over time, dust, animal dander, pollen, and various contaminants can settle deeply within the rug's material, leading to poor indoor air quality and potential allergic reactions. Standard vacuuming may prove insufficient, as it frequently cannot access the underlying layers where these particles reside.
Professional cleaning services utilize specialized equipment and methods to extract these deep-set contaminants. Hot water extraction, steam cleaning, and other methods are employed to lift dirt and allergens from the fibers without causing damage. This deep cleaning not only enhances the appearance of the rug but also promotes a healthier living environment. By tackling these hidden pollutants, homeowners can guarantee their oriental rugs remain not only beautiful but also safe for all occupants, especially those with sensitivities.

Avoiding Mildew and Mold Formation
To prevent mold and mildew development on oriental rugs, preserving a dry and well-ventilated environment is essential. Too much moisture creates an ideal breeding ground for these fungi, which can damage the integrity of the rug fibers and produce unpleasant odors. Regularly checking for dampness in the surrounding area can help discover potential issues early on.
